466 Bronte Rd, Bronte is a 5 bedroom, 3 bathroom House with 2 parking spaces and was built in 1920. The property has a land size of 561m2 and floor size of 230m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in February 2023.

The size of Bronte is approximately 1.3 square kilometres. It has 13 parks covering nearly 11.7% of total area. The population of Bronte in 2016 was 6733 people. By 2021 the population was 7166 showing a population growth of 6.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Bronte is 30-39 years. Households in Bronte are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Bronte work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 59.00% of the homes in Bronte were owner-occupied compared with 60.00% in 2016.
Bronte has 3,606 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Bronte have seen a 71.33%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 30.00% increase. As at 31 October 2025:
